Post by: Shayne on September 23, 2005, 04:06:14 PM
Just because they are a shareholder doesnt mean they have access to source.  Microsoft also doesnt have a controlling interest.



Microsoft invest $150M into apple in the form of "non-voting shares" at a time when Apple had over $1B in the liquid cash, not including the actual value of the company.  I think in the area of 2% company value?
